The aim of the MSc course in Public Health is to train specialists capable of monitoring public health problems, as well as planning, implementing and evaluating possible solutions.
The objective of the MSc course in Public Health is to equip graduates with knowledge and skills in
monitoring the health status of population;
analysing the factors influencing the health status of populations;
exploring and prioritising health needs and demands;
drafting local, regional and national health policy aimed at solving public health concerns;
planning and organising services to promote health, prevent and treat diseases based on the needs of the target population;
implementing and managing health-promoting and disease-prevention tactics
analysing and evaluating the effectiveness of those services and interventions.
Specialists who have completed their studies will have thorough knowledge in epidemiology, health promotion, health care management, and health care policy.
